There are different kind of energies produced from sea. They are:
  • Tidal energy: Tidal energy is harnessed by constructing a dam across a narrow opening to the sea. A turbine fixed at the opening of the dam converts tidal energy to electricity.
  • Wave energy: electric power generated from waves
  • Ocean current energy: ocean surface is comparable to wind which rotates the turbine to generate electricity.
  • Ocean thermal energy: the warm surface-water is used to boil a volatile liquid like ammonia. The vapours of the liquid are then used to run the turbine of generator.

But energy from biomass, solar energy are not produced from seas. Hence they are not forms of oceanic energy.
